Barry loewer descartes skeptical and antiskeptical arguments received in revised form june, 1980 introduction in the first meditation descartes constructs a series of skeptical arguments which culminates in the argument from the possibility of a deceiving god. Descartes countenances the possibility that there might be an allpowerful god who ensures that we are always deceived, even about the most general of beliefs.
